Sand Ceremony
Me: Daijon and LaShae, today you have made sacred vows to finalize your union. To symbolize this new union, you will now combine these vials of sand to seal your spiritual bond.
Daijon and LaShae will each receive a vial of sand of their favorite color.
You each hold in your hand a distinct vessel of sand. Gaze into this vessel, allowing the sand within to symbolize your individual life. Visualize each grain of sand as a moment in time; either one that has already come and gone, or one yet to pass. This sand represents the waves endured over the course of time, every trial and tribulation that has been thrown your way. By the same token, it also encapsulates your joys, your achievements, and your triumphs. Reflect on these experiences, and the strength required to achieve your goals or overcome your challenges.
Together, slowly pour your sand into the common vessel.
Daijon and LaShae will then simultaneously pour their sand out into larger vessel
Just as your individual sands have combined together and melded into one, so too, Daijon and LaShae, will your lives be forever joined from this day forward. Similar to the grains of sand, your lives, now combined, can never be separated.
You will share your love, your joy, your hopes, your dreams and your fears with one another. Notice, too, that your mutual vessel of sand is now larger and more impressive – just as your lives have gained depth and meaning thanks to the love and support of your partner. Moving forward throughout life, always recognize the importance of this bond you share.

Me: Daijon and LaShae, today you have taken the vows of marriage. To mark the transition of starting your new life together, we will now commence the tradition of jumping the broom.
Jumping the broom is a symbolic ritual rooted in African and African-American culture, associated with marriage ceremonies. It historically signified a couple's union, especially during slavery when formal marriages were not legally recognized. Today, it celebrates love, heritage, and commitment in modern weddings.
